summaryrefslogtreecommitdiff
path: root/51-run-unit-tests.sh
diff options
context:
space:
mode:
Diffstat (limited to '51-run-unit-tests.sh')
-rwxr-xr-x51-run-unit-tests.sh10
1 files changed, 8 insertions, 2 deletions
diff --git a/51-run-unit-tests.sh b/51-run-unit-tests.sh
index 3f9671e..ce294ef 100755
--- a/51-run-unit-tests.sh
+++ b/51-run-unit-tests.sh
@@ -11,10 +11,16 @@ logfile=$(log_filename $ID)
LIBCAMERA=${1:-$(srcdir libcamera)}
BUILDDIR=${2:-$(builddir unit-tests)}
-set -e
-
check_version "$LIBCAMERA" "$ID"
+# Check that our test modules are loaded.
+modules=$(lsmod | grep -E -c "^vim2m|^vimc|^vivid")
+
+[ $modules == 3 ]
+pass_fail $? "Module load check"
+
+
+# Run the unit-tests
ninja -C $BUILDDIR test
completed $ID